dc.description.abstractCombined lead, sulphur and oxygen isotopes have been analysed in ore (galena and sphalerite) and associated (quartz, barite) minerals from the Mazarambroz Pb-Zn mineralization. Lead isotopic model ages in galenas cluster around 121 ± 8 Ma in good agreement with previously suggested mesozoic age of this Pb-Zn mineralization estimated by apatite fission tracks in mylonitic wall-rocks. Isotopic composition of Mazarambroz mineralization suggests a high rock (metamorphic/granitic)/fluid interaction with minor participation of meteoric waters. These fluids circulated deeply along fragile cracks of the major shear zone of Toledoen_US
